Häufige Fragen: Condensation vs Dew vs Liquid
Was ist der Unterschied zwischen Condensation, Dew und Liquid?
Condensation: The process of changing from gas to liquid. Dew: Tiny drops of water that form on surfaces in the morning. Liquid: A substance that flows freely and is not solid.
Was ist häufiger: Condensation, Dew und Liquid?
Liquid ist im Alltagsenglisch am häufigsten.
Kannst du zu jedem ein Beispiel zeigen?
Condensation: The condensation on the window illustrated the high humidity in the room. Dew: The grass was covered in morning dew. Liquid: She poured the dark brown liquid down the sink.
